Ticket: Staging env misconfigured for Siftgate bloom filter

The bloom layer in front of the Pellet KV store is rejecting all lookups in staging because the env file was copied from the dev template without credentials. False-positive tuning values are fine; only the auth line is missing. To unblock the weekly demo, the Pellet admission secret must be set on the following line.

env line for yaguf-fajop: LEDGER_TOKEN13=fb08984397349

Runbook 4.2 — Locked device case, Quillan Labs run. Heads up: the grey hard case holds twelve pre-release test units and stays locked the whole trip — we don't carry the key, Quillan does. Driver keeps it in the cab, not the cargo bay, and doesn't stack anything on it. If the route changes, call the run lead before deviating. Brief your driver on the hand-over step below.

handover note for yagef-bagep: the drudor pelius courier leaves the kasdor zorvan norir ledger at gate 8016 under passcode 755406

// This constant caps backtracking depth for the Wordloft crossword
// generator. Raising it past 12 caused exponential slowdowns on dense
// 21x21 grids during last week's profiling session; lowering it below
// 8 rejected too many valid fills. We'll revisit at the weekly sync
// once the new solver lands. The benchmark run that fixed this value
// is identified by the token below.

session token of yahof-bajeg = htk9_0d43d44ed

Hey Marisol — handing off LiftLab, our elevator-dispatch simulator, before I head out. Plugin authors hook into the dispatch tick via the scheduler API; docs are in the repo wiki. Watch out: the hall-call queue resets on config reload, which trips up third-party plugins constantly. The sandbox vault needs re-unlocking after each deploy. To unlock it, use the recovery passphrase below.

unlock words, yawig-kagef: gordor-holvan-ulaael-pramir-ulaiel-tamdor